Smart planning for efficiency
When starting a home project, consider how passive design strategies can cut energy use from day one. Orientation, shading, and airtight building envelopes reduce heating and cooling loads. A thoughtful site assessment informs window placement to maximize daylight while minimizing unwanted heat gain. Systems that save energy without compromise
Modern mechanical systems offer efficiency gains without sacrificing user experience. Efficient heating and cooling, coupled with smart thermostats and zoning, tailor climate control to occupancy. Proper ventilation with energy recovery keeps air fresh while limiting energy loss. Lighting upgrades, including LEDs and smart controls, reduce consumption and extend bulb life. Integrating these systems early helps homeowners enjoy dependable comfort and lower utility bills over time.
Outdoor design that supports efficiency
Landscaping and exterior design influence microclimates around the home. Strategic tree placement, shade structures, and reflective surfaces manage heat gain and loss. Vegetation can buffer wind, while properly designed roof overhangs protect sun exposure in summer. Durable, low-maintenance exteriors reduce the need for frequent upkeep, which itself consumes energy. Thoughtful outdoor design harmonizes with indoor living, enhancing energy performance and curb appeal without adding complexity to everyday living.
